In 2020, a number of intelligent robot-related conferences were held: - On August 10th, 2020, the 2020 Global Artificial Intelligence and Robotics Summit (2020 CCF-GAKAR) hosted by the China Computer Society opened in Shen Zhen. - On the morning of November 19th, the 2020 China (Guangdong) International Intelligent Robot Exposition, the 2020 Global Intelligent Robot Industry Summit, and the 2020 World Robot Competition press conference were held in Foshan City. The China (Guangzhou) International Intelligent Robot Exhibition was held at the Tanzhou International Convention and Exhibition Center in Guangzhou from December 3 to 6, and the "2020 World Robot Competition Finals" was held in Guangzhou at the same time. - On November 13 - 14, 2020, the 2020 China-Europe Intelligent Robot Conference and Robot Core components and Key Technologies Forum was successfully held in Beijing in an online + offline mode. Musk showed off the prototype of the humanoid robot called the Prime at Tesla's artificial intelligence conference. This robot could complete some simple tasks independently, such as moving goods. The Prime was 5 feet 8 inches tall and weighed 125 pounds. It was estimated to retail for no more than $20,000 each. Musk said that Tesla plans to launch the TeslaBot prototype in 2022 and is expected to produce millions of units in the next few years, with the final price of less than $20,000. The conference showed off some of the functions of the Prime, such as the ability to water plants and carry materials. Musk hoped to attract the world's most talented people to join Tesla through this conference to help achieve mass production and further development of humanoid robots. Tesla's humanoid robot project was an important move by Tesla in the field of artificial intelligence. Musk believed that this would be a complete transformation of human civilization.
Musk announced the plan for the artificial intelligence robot at the 2021 Tesla Artificial Intelligence Day conference. He said that Tesla would launch a humanoid robot prototype called TeslaBot in 2022. The robot was 5 feet 8 inches tall and weighed 125 pounds. It was equipped with Tesla's self-developed AI chip and camera. Musk said the robot would be able to complete dangerous, repetitive or boring tasks in human life. He also mentioned that Tesla already had the parts needed to build humanoid robots because they had already built robots with wheels, which were known as Tesla cars. Musk plans to mass-produce the robot in the next few years, and the final price is expected to be less than $20,000. This robot is expected to play a role in the family, factory and other fields, becoming a partner or companion of humans.
The 2024 World Intelligent Manufacturing Conference will be held in Nanjing City, Jiangsu Province on December 20 - 22. Its theme will be "Intelligent Manufacturing Strong Foundation, Integration and innovation". Admitting to the idea of "high-end, international, professional, and systematic", it will present four innovation highlights. With "artificial intelligence + manufacturing" as the technical direction, it will release and interpret the "National Intelligent Factory Graded Cultivation Plan" and "National Intelligent Manufacturing Solution Unveils" and other achievements at the theme conference. Build and perfect the entire ecological chain of intelligent manufacturing. The conference will also showcase new products, new technologies, and diverse application scenarios in the field of intelligent manufacturing. Special seminar activities will be held to discuss the transformation and upgrading path of the manufacturing industry driven by artificial intelligence and the application prospects of aerospace intelligent manufacturing technology. An intelligent robot was a robot product that had a humanoid appearance and human characteristics, and could replace or assist humans in their work. They could play an important role in many fields such as industry, medicine, education, and home, improving work efficiency and quality of life. The intelligent robot used advanced deep learning algorithms and artificial intelligence technology, which had strong learning and adaptability. They could simulate human movements and postures, understand and execute instructions in multiple languages, and have smooth conversations with people. Intelligent robots also had powerful sensory abilities. They could sense the surrounding environment through cameras, sensors, and other devices to make accurate judgments and decisions.
